Transaction 34698e85f645ef7528e62ddeaa153defc81a3e55308803db2959aa413d774fa7

23 Input
2 Outputs
  • 34698e85f645ef7528e62ddeaa153defc81a3e55308803db2959aa413d774fa7:0
  • value  41943050
    address  1F2nUjBjdQeBbWaK2XV6vDzcnC8eJJihiH
  • 34698e85f645ef7528e62ddeaa153defc81a3e55308803db2959aa413d774fa7:1
  • value  18735254
    address  3AnHEBvW1VeyyoVPY3YvwLrVfgShqRQkNZ